Discussie forum over Weather Display software. Voor vragen, specificaties, ervaringen etc..

Door Thorbon
#11068
Aangezien het vorige topic gesloten is hierover, ben ik maar een nieuw gestart.. mss kan het eventueel verplaatst worden indien nodig..

Is er al een kleine handleidig of oplossing hoe een huid weericoon op de website te laten komen adhv het verschil tussen de temperatuur in de anemometer en de temperatuurmeter in de schaduw betreffende de weerstations cresta, tfa nexus, honeywell enz.. ?

Ik had graag mijn eigen fotootjes gemaakt(een van regen, wind, bewolkt en zonnig) en deze via weatherdisplay up te loaden indien het regent enz.. Nu heb ik enkel een uv sensor en die extra sensor in mijn anemometer (die in de zon staat) Aan de hand van deze fotootjes en berekingen (al dan niet door WD) had ik graag het huidige weer op mijn website tevoorschijn willen laten komen..

meer info over vorig topic --> http://www.hetweeractueel.nl/forum/weat ... kbaar#3816
Door wslangerak
#11071
Michael en andere geïnteresseerden,

1. Eerst het WD-icoon met bijbehorend tag-nummer.
In Weather-Display wordt een weericoon gegenereerd, dat ook in het WD-hoofdscherm te zien is, bijvoorbeeld deze:



Dit icoon heeft een nummer. Dit nummer (in clientraw.txt is het positie 48) kan je gebruiken om in een (php-)script een zelfgemaakt plaatje te laten zien op je website. Of je plaatst gewoon het standaard WD-icoon op je site. Dit wordt dan automatisch ververst.

2. Hoe komt het icoon tot stand?
Dat kan op verschillende manieren. Als je in WD automatisch een METAR download (= Meteorological Aerodrome Report, weerapport opgemaakt door luchthavens) kan je ervoor kiezen deze METAR je "current conditions" in WD te laten bepalen. Als het bijvoorbeeld op de locatie van de METAR zwaar bewolkt is, krijg je een zwaarbewolkt-icoon te zien. Ook al schijnt bij jou de zon. Kan je een METAR vinden van een vliegveld niet al te ver bij jou vandaan levert dit vaak een redelijk beeld op. Maar ter plekke bepalen wat voor weertype het is is natuurlijk altijd het beste. Als je een solarsensor hebt kan je aan de hand daarvan de "current conditions" laten bepalen.

3. Geen solar sensor, dan solar-in-a-jar met extra temp sensor.
In de anemometer van o.a. de TFA-Nexus zit een extra temperatuur sensor. Aangezien de windmeter meestal in de volle zon zit kunnen we deze extra temp gebruiken om een indicatie van de zonneschijn te krijgen volgens het solar-in-a-jar principe. De sensor zit wel niet in een (glazen) potje, maar goed... het werkt redelijk in WD als je een beetje experimenteert met de instellingen.

4. Instellingen
In WD ga naar Control panel > Solar sensor. Daar vind je een tabblad met solar in a jar instellingen. Het principe gaat er van uit dat de temperatuur in de zon een x-aantal graden hoger is dan die in de schaduw. Logisch toch? Dit temperatuurverschil wordt groter naarmate de sensor meer zon ontvangt. De temperatuursettings 0% zon en 100% zon kunnen hier worden gemaakt. De minimum instelling is dus voor 0% en de maximum voor 100%. Mijn instellingen staan op -1.6 en 5.3 (jawel, lijkt vreemd maar het werkt goed!). Een voorbeeld van het resultaat zie je hier:

http://81.70.227.124:8080/solar.jpg

Op de andere tabbladen kun je aangeven welke (nederlandse) naam je geeft aan een bepaald percentage zon. Als je WD aangeeft dat de "current conditions" worden bepaald door je solar setup (en 's avonds/'s nachts door de METAR) heb je altijd een redelijk nauwkeurige weericoon, met bijbehorend nummer in de clientraw.txt.
Dat nummer kan je zoals gezegd in het begin van dit relaas gebruiken om een eigen plaatje te laten zien op je website.

Wellicht dat hierdoor nog meer vragen rijzen. Stel ze maar en we hopen ze met elkaar te kunnen beantwoorden.

Groeten,
Kees.
Bijlagen
forecasticon.gif
forecasticon.gif (5.14 KiB) 3333 keer bekeken
Door Thorbon
#11074
lijkt me alvast een zeer duidelijke uitleg waarvoor dank, maar het zal toch goed zoeken worden voor mij:) zelfs al om zo'n weerplaatje met temperatuur op te krijgen. Voor WD ben ik nog echt een leek al begint de structuur lichtjes door te sijpelen. vanavond of morgen eens bekijken en me er dan vanaf volgende week eens volledig op toelichten.. u hoort nog wel van mij ;)
Door wslangerak
#11091
Bij de TFA-Nexus-achtigen is het sensor 8.

Probeer als min temp 1.1 en als max 7.1 als proef. Dan experimenteren met die temperaturen.

De offset op 0 laten staan, géén vinkje bij "I have an adapted temphum sensor", wél een vinkje bij "Use solar in a jar to override.."

Main switch niet vergeten op "ON" te zetten.

Kan je vast weer verder... Succes!
Door Thorbon
#11102
ok ik denk dat alles correct staat..Volgende dagen eens bekijken..
Als ik het goed heb, wordt alles wat je kan uploaden ook eigenlijk in clientraw opgeslagen?Of is er nog een file? dus als je php gebruikt en deze file kan inlezen en de woorden er kan uithalen, kan je de meeste data ongeveer zelf maken? Is het niet makkelijker dat alles in een xml staat?

wel probeerde ik via upload die clientraw up te loaden maar tot hiertoe wijzigt er niets aan de gegevens..morgenavond eens opnieuw proberen.. alvast bedankt voor de uitleg voor de zonnestralen.. Ik merk dat bij mij de temp van windchill ook beduidend hoger is als de zon schijnt dus dit zou moeten lukken..
Door Thorbon
#11126
de weersituatie werkt perfect.. waarvoor dank.. Ik vraag me eigenlijk wel af hoe WD dat doet, maarja zolang WD het doet is het al goed hé;)
Hoe kan je dit eigenlijk correct gebruiker voor aantal zonuren qua instellingen?is dit mogelijk ?
Ook vraag ik me af hoe jij die mooie grafiek ermee kon maken?

heb heb gezien dat alle data in wdfulldata.xml komt.. mss is het best dit dan te gebruiken om alles uit te lezen via php? of niet?
Door wslangerak
#11163
De gegevens zitten inderdaad in de wdfulldata.xml, maar ook in de clientraw files en (in de directory ..\\\\wdisplay\\\\log) in de xx2009vantagelog.txt
Laatstgenoemde gebruik je eventueel voor grafieken, vanwege de logfunctie.

Ik gebruik hiervoor het programma GraphWeather, zie:
http://www.aguilmard.com/index.php?page=graphweathercpp,
maar er zijn natuurlijk meer mogelijkheden zoals:
JPGraph (http://www.aditus.nu/jpgraph/),
Open Flash Charts (http://teethgrinder.co.uk/open-flash-chart/) en
Maani (http://www.maani.us/xml_charts/),
waarvan de laatste niet gratis is.
Door Thorbon
#11185
hey dat eerste ziet er inderdaad handig uit.. gebruik jij de gegevens van mysql dan? of een andere plugin?
Ik had ook nog een vraagje (maar dan wijk ik even uit van het topic) ik had mijn eigen iconen geplaatst in myicons in de WDisplaymap zoals in manual staat, maar toch krijg ik nog steeds niet mijn eigen iconen.. moet ik dit nog ergens aanvinken?
Door wslangerak
#11190
Voor GraphWeather gebruik ik de CSV.dll plugin samen met de logfiles van WD, zoals nu 52009lg.txt. Werkt perfect.

Maar je kunt natuurlijk ook kiezen voor de MySQL plugin als je een database laat vullen door WD. 't Is maar net wat je wilt.

Wat betreft de iconen: in WD klik op "Input daily weather" (meest rechtse menu-item) dan tabblad "Select main screen icon". Dan zou je je nieuwe iconen moeten zien als ze in de goede directory staan (c:\\\\wdisplay\\\\myicons). Ze moeten wel exact dezelfde naam hebben als de originele files. Dan klikken op "Update for the first time" (ofzoiets).

Als je ze dan nog niet ziet, kan je op de eerste dubbelklikken en dan via browse naar de file gaan die je wilt gebruiken. Dan moet hij zeker zichtbaar zijn.
Overigens moet je nadat je de icons in de myicons dir hebt gezet WD wel opnieuw opstarten.